A beautiful clear, dry evening this year for an enthusiastic crowd to enjoy the Christmas Lights switch-on in Emsworth, carols in the square and the arrival of Santa on Havant Rotary Club's magnificent sleigh.
A great start to the Christmas season in Emsworth!
The crowds joined in with Carols sung by children from local schools and Havant's Mayor and Havant Rotarian Councillor Faith Ponsonby accompanied by consort Michael Ponsonby were there to switch on the Christmas lights in the square as the brightly-lit and always popular sleigh processed through the town centre down to the quay. There he was called upon to switch on the lights illuminating the Lobster Pot tree on the quayside before retiring to his grotto to welcome children from all over who queued patiently in the cold to meet Santa.
